EDIT: SOLVED. The ship's sil.tga was twice the size it should have been. Converted it and edited it in Paint to regular size. Converted it back and voila.
Original post: Thought I might post this in the relevant thread: I have the MFM+ skins working with GWX3 + J to Z Destroyers + fixes + MaGui + WS fix. There is only a small issue with the ship AK01A which has a super magnified image in the rec manual (a section with a mast and chimney, blown up in size), making it impossible to see what the ship looks like. Is there a known issue either with that ship or with the mod coworking with other mods? Last edited by Von Due; 04-13-16 at 05:57 AM. |

Quote:
If you are curious about its usage, use Task Manager, and look under the processes tab for sh3.exe. It should reach no more than 3,800,000 K or so, before it crash. This number changes depending on many variables, but it will be somewhere in that ball park. War Elite mod, latest edition will ctd the game because of too many units for example. |
